Thabo Kawana, Permanent Secretary of the Ministry of Information and Media, represented Zambia at a landmark signing ceremony to onboard Zambia News and Information Services (ZANIS TV) onto the MultiChoice Group ’s DStv platform. This partnership marks a significant step in expanding the reach of Zambian media both locally and internationally.
Speaking at the event, Kawana described the move as a “game-changer for our media industry,” emphasizing that it will allow every Zambian, at home and abroad, to have a front-row seat to the developmental projects and policies of the New Dawn Administration.
During the ceremony, concerns raised by viewers were addressed, with Kawana urging MultiChoice to:
- Address high subscription fees
- Reduce content repetition
- Ensure that ZNBC TV remains available as a Free-To-Air channel
Kawana concluded by encouraging the ZANIS team to continue telling the Zambian story with professionalism and integrity, noting that the world is now watching.
